Look up filter behavior in BS 6.x and 7.x explained in MAM WOTRACK

Question & Answer


Question

Why is the Owner selection for a work order, filtered from the look-up , based on the previously selected owner group?

Answer

To explain the behavior firstly , observe the steps to reproduce this scenario as follows:


1.) Navigate to the Maximo Work Order Tracking application and open any active work order. 2.) From the Select Action menu, select the option "Select Owner"
3.) From the opened dialogue box select the look up button for the field "Owner/Group" 4.) From the look up of "persons" and "person groups" , select any person group and select the "OK" button.
5.) Now the selected owner group value is populated in the Owner Group field. 6.) Now repeat the steps 2 & 3.
7.) The look up opens with the "persons" tab active.
8.) It can be observed that the "persons" list is filtered from the previously selected Person Group.

This is working as intended in that the initially selected Owner Group, say for example 1001 is assigned to the WO as the Owner Group.
So by design it passes that value to the Filter in the select owner dialog - to only show people who are members of the Owner group currently assigned to the Ticket / Work order

This is implemented functionality back from Maximo 6.x onwards.

The users can clear the filter in the dialog and select a person from any Owner group, just trying to make it easier this way on the initial selection.
